"youthly" meaning in English

See youthly in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Adjective

IPA: /ˈjuːθli/ Forms: more youthly [comparative], most youthly [superlative]
Etymology: From youth + -ly, possibly continuing Old English ġeoguþlīċ (through Middle English *youthely), but more likely a new formation.   1. (archaic) Youthful. Tags: archaic Synonyms: juvenile, youthsome
